Transaction 28988cf60a2f3ecfbec9f140783481bd3c246f9d4be015f9381ca6de13fe1a8f

1 Input
2 Outputs
  • 28988cf60a2f3ecfbec9f140783481bd3c246f9d4be015f9381ca6de13fe1a8f:0
  • value  1511330
    address  36bfiSLX4cG4kHbpujh3eSJrM8m15owTPa
  • 28988cf60a2f3ecfbec9f140783481bd3c246f9d4be015f9381ca6de13fe1a8f:1
  • value  5968
    address  32GPUgwcY2YbBa4JPzykVGEp4U6JvyQUs8